Output ed659f6c81baaa09eef129aecf4d9779bbeecd9b5f29b173b0eea8eb2bde92a2: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254af73294788d7ba74ece060c1cb8577c302bcc OP_EQUAL
address
9uqTUBxZkjm1E6TEp5u43Z4ytp1UB2wpYk
transaction
ed659f6c81baaa09eef129aecf4d9779bbeecd9b5f29b173b0eea8eb2bde92a2